What will AGI do for Sub-Nanometer Calibration Failures?

Semiconductor fabs operate lithography and metrology equipment that demands alignment precision down to fractions of a nanometer. Fab engineers and tool operators face constant yield losses when this alignment drifts during high-volume manufacturing. Even microscopic shifts from mechanical vibration, thermal expansion, or electromagnetic interference push the optical pathways out of tolerance, causing overlay errors that ruin entire batches of advanced logic and memory wafers.
